In the rapidly evolving world of cryptocurrency, Binance Exchange has emerged as one of the leading platforms for trading digital assets. One of the most popular trading pairs on Binance is BTC to ETH. This article aims to provide a comprehensive guide on how to trade BTC to ETH on Binance Exchange.
Binance Exchange is a global cryptocurrency exchange that was founded in 2017. It is known for its high liquidity, low trading fees, and user-friendly interface. The platform supports a wide range of digital assets, including Bit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H), making it an ideal choice for traders looking to trade BTC to ETH.
Trading BTC to ETH on Binance Exchange is a straightforward process.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you get started:
1. Sign up for a Binance account: To begin trading BTC to ETH on Binance Exchange, you need to create an account. Visit the Binance website and click on the "Register" button. Fill in the required details, including your email address and password, and complete the verification process.
2. Deposit BTC into your Binance account: Once you have created an account, you need to deposit BTC into your Binance wallet. You can do this by clicking on the "Funds" tab, selecting "Deposits," and choosing BTC from the list of available assets. Copy the BTC deposit address and use it to send BTC from your external wallet to your Binance account.
3. Trade BTC for ETH: After your BTC deposit has been confirmed, you can start trading BTC for ETH. Click on the "Exchange" tab, select "Basic" or "Advanced" depending on your trading experience, and search for the BTC/ETH trading pair. Once you have found the pair, click on it, and you will see a trading interface with two columns: "Buy" and "Sell."
4. Place a buy order: To trade BTC for ETH, you need to place a buy order. In the "Buy" column, you can choose to place a market order, which will execute your trade at the current market price, or a limit order, which will execute your trade at a specific price. Enter the amount of BTC you want to trade and click on "Buy ETH."
5. Withdraw your ETH: Once your BTC has been traded for ETH, you can withdraw your ETH to your external wallet. Click on the "Funds" tab, select "Withdrawals," and choose ETH from the list of available assets. Enter your ETH withdrawal address and the amount you want to withdraw, and complete the withdrawal process.
Trading BTC to ETH on Binance Exchange offers several benefits, including:
1. High liquidity: Binance Exchange has a high trading volume, which means that you can execute your trades quickly and at a fair price.
2. Low trading fees: Binance Exchange offers some of the lowest trading fees in the industry, which can help you save money on your trades.
3. User-friendly interface: The Binance Exchange platform is easy to use, even for beginners. The interface is intuitive, and the platform offers a range of tools and resources to help you make informed trading decisions.
